Udumbanchola Assembly constituency


Udumbanchola State assembly constituency is one of the 140 state legislative assembly constituencies in Kerala in southern India. It is also one of the seven state legislative assembly constituencies included in Idukki Lok Sabha constituency. As of the 2021 Assembly elections, the current MLA is M. M. Mani of CPI(M).

Local self-governed segments

Udumbanchola Assembly constituency is composed of the following local self-governed segments:
Sl no.NameStatus Taluk
1ErattayarGrama panchayatUdumbanchola
2KarunapuramGrama panchayatUdumbanchola
3NedumkandamGrama panchayatUdumbanchola
4PampadumparaGrama panchayatUdumbanchola
5RajakkadGrama panchayatUdumbanchola
6RajakumariGrama panchayatUdumbanchola
7SanthanparaGrama panchayatUdumbanchola
8SenapathyGrama panchayatUdumbanchola
9UdumbancholaGrama panchayatUdumbanchola
10VandanmeduGrama panchayatUdumbanchola
